The NFL threw out all ties in the standings through the 1971 season, leading to weirdness like the 7-3-3 Steelers having a chance to overtake the 10-3 Giants in the last week of the 1963 season.

ties from the 20s and 30s are weird because a lot of times, they're handled as if they game didn't happen. 1933 Minnesota was a Big Ten co-champ despite only winning two conference games because they tied at 1.000 win% with Michigan, who won five conference games and the national title that year
